Pills & Automobiles is a single by Chris Brown, released in 2017. A vibrant blend of Afrobeats and contemporary R&B, pulsing with infectious rhythms and smooth melodies. 'Pills & Automobiles' peaked at number 65 on the Billboard Hot 100 and showcased Brown's ability to adapt to evolving musical trends, particularly the growing influence of Afrobeats in American pop culture. The track features contributions from notable artists like A Boogie Wit Da Hoodie and Kodak Black, further emphasizing its relevance in the hip-hop landscape of the late 2010s. By the time 'Pills & Automobiles' was released in August 2017, Chris Brown was navigating a complex career marked by both commercial success and personal controversies. This single arrived amidst his ongoing efforts to reinvent himself artistically following a series of legal issues and public scrutiny, aiming to tap into the rising popularity of Afrobeats within mainstream music.
